Child Life Specialist Job Summary

Child Life Services - ICN (Intensive Care Nursery)

Full Time

88196

This position is focused in the Intensive Care Nursery. The Certified Child Life Specialist (CCLS) plays a pivotal role, building a sustainable, developmentally supportive, and family-centered program. Focusing on the unique neurodevelopmental needs of premature infants, the CCLS will build a service incorporating education, play and sensory regulation techniques. Supports caregiver bonding to create healthy attachments and offers interventions that address medical trauma, long-term hospitalization and uncertain outcomes.

Coordinates programming and special events for pediatric patients and their families in Child Life Services programming spaces. Provides orientation and supervision for Child Life Services interns and volunteers. Assists in training and orientation of new hires. Works under the supervision of the Child Life Director.

Required Qualifications CLS I:
  • Minimum qualifications for application include a Bachelor's degree in Education, Child Life, Child Development or a related field, Master's degree preferred.
  • Child Life internship under the supervision of a certified Child Life Specialist (600 hours) and
  • Proof of eligibility for Child Life certification is required, certification preferred. Must be certified within 18 months of hire.
  • One year of paid experience preferred but not required.

Must complete CLS I competencies within 6 months of hire:
These include:

  • Environment of Care (Programming)
  • Assessment - Child Development and Family Systems
  • Age Specific Interventions
  • Preparation for Medical Treatments and Procedures
  • Procedural Support and Coping
  • Therapeutic Play
  • Documentation and Charting
  • Volunteer Supervision
CLS II:

Minimum qualifications for application include a Masters' degree in Education, Child Life, Child Development or a related field, or 5 years of experience.

  • Child Life Certification required
  • Minimum of 2 years' paid experience as a Child Life Specialist required.
  • Must complete CLS II competencies within 6 months of hire:
    These include all CLS I competencies plus:
  • Student Internship Supervision
  • End of Life Care
  • Cultural Awareness
  • Professionalism
  • Special needs
